Fiji Police Commissioner resigns

November 10, 2015 5:44 am

Police Commissioner Ben Groenewald has resigned from his position.

In a statement this evening, Government says Groenewald asked for an early release from his contractual appointment as the Commissioner of the Fiji Police Force effective from today.

He cited personal and family reasons for his early exit.

Following advice from Prime Minister as the Chair of the Constitutional Offices Commission, the President Ratu Epeli Nailatikau has appointed Colonel Sitiveni Tukaituraga Qiliho as the Acting Commissioner of the Fiji Police Force with effect from tomorrow.

The appointment is for a period of three months or when a substantive appointment is made to the position of the Commissioner of the Fiji Police Force.

A draft advertisement for the position of the Commissioner of Police has been circulated to the members of the Constitutional Offices Commission.

Upon finalisation of the advertisement, the position will be advertised at the earliest.

The President has thanked Groenewald for his service and wished him all the best in his future endeavours.
